Question by Jon W: Can i really save thousands at a government car auction?
im looking to buy a new car and i found this website that tells you where the auctions are and everything. Can i really save thousands buying a car from this auction? If you have bought a vehicle from one of these before list it, the retail price, and the price you got it for.
Best answer:
Answer by Vipassana
Can you? Yes.
Will you? Most likely not.
Keep in mind, it’s an auction. So let’s say you see a nice BMW you want, and it’s only $ 500.
It won’t sell at $ 500. People will see it, think they can get it for cheap, and the bidding begins.
By the time you’re done, it’s close to how much you would have paid through a private seller anyway.
